Methaqualone Quantitative, Urine
Also known as: METHAQ UR
Use
This test is used for the quantitative measurement of methaqualone in urine, aiding in the detection of methaqualone use. It provides a measure of the concentration of methaqualone in the urine sample, which can be useful in clinical settings to monitor drug intake or verify abstinence.

Specimen
Urine
Volume
2 mL
Minimum Volume
0.7 mL
Container
ARUP Standard Transport Tube
Collection Instructions
Transfer 2 mL urine to an ARUP Standard Transport Tube.
Stability Requirements
| Temperature | Period |
|---|---|
| Room Temperature | 1 week |
| Refrigerated | 2 weeks |
| Frozen | 1 year |
